Novotown integrated resort opens in Zhuhai

Hong Kong’s Lai Sun Group has announced the official opening of Novotown, an integrated resort (IR) and entertainment hub on Hengqin Island in Zhuhai, China. Novotown combines state-of-the-art entertainment with world-class leisure experiences.

Novotown’s key attractions, Lionsgate Entertainment World and National Geographic Ultimate Explorer, opened in July and September.

Speaking at the IR’s opening ceremony, Larry Leung, managing director of Novotown, said it looks to deliver “innovative entertainment and leisure experiences” and provide residents of Zhuhai and Macau with “a state-of-the-art entertainment destination unlike any other”.

“With world-class themed entertainment facilities, Novotown will not only offer more choices for a short getaway within the ‘one-hour lifestyle circle’, but also help to create a ‘one trip, multi-stop’ tourism model within the Greater Bay Area,” added Leung.

Lionsgate Entertainment World is one of China’s most technologically-advanced theme parks, using vir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) in its rides and attractions.

The interactive destination boasts more than 50 key attractions based on Lionsgate’s film franchises, including The Hunger Games and the Twilight Saga.

Also at Novotown is the first National Geographic Ultimate Explorer centre in Southern China. The family-friendly educational attraction includes 13 breathtaking experiences, merging content from the National Geographic brand with immersive entertainment.

In addition, Novotown is home to various retail and dining brands, as well as the Hyatt Regency Hengqin hotel.

To celebrate the opening, Novotown has launched the ‘Golden Town’ carnival, running until January 2020 with special offers and activities.

‘Golden Town’ will feature four golden interactive installations, including ‘Golden Station’, ‘Dream Station’, ‘Lucky Station’ and ‘Sparkle Station’ – a 7.2-metre LED digital Christmas tree.

Coming in phase two of Novotown is Real Madrid World, a Ducati-themed motorcycle experience centre, and ILA Hengqin with Harrow International.
